We help businesses eliminate wasted ad spend in paid search advertising.

Our clients have saved millions of dollars on Google Ads and Bing Ads, with our optimization tools, for over the past 5+ years. We recently extended our services and solutions for Amazon Ads. Here are the solutions available for Amazon Ads

1) Negative Keywords Tool - Our tool gives negative keywords recommendations that helps advertisers reduce their advertising spend and driving good quality traffic.

2) Search Archival Feature - With this feature advertisers can easily archive their search query data for more than 60 days (currently Amazon Ads has no option to view historical data beyond 60 days)

3) Shared Negative Keywords List - Amazon Ads does not have the option of Shared Negative Keywords List. We have built a tool which helps create account level negative keywords and associate them to multiple campaigns.

4)Ad Scheduling Feature - With this feature advertisers can show their ads during more productive hour(s) of the day or day(s) of the week.

Call Flow is an AI training platform for sales and customer support teams. Instead of learning on real customers, reps practice realistic calls against AI-powered buyers and callers — then get instant, objective feedback on every session.

How it works

  1. Practice realistic AI calls. Choose from 700+ real-world scenarios across seven categories (hosting & infrastructure, website & commerce, refunds & cancellations, compliance & privacy, de-escalation, soft skills, and custom scenarios). Six caller temperaments and three difficulty levels mean no two calls play out the same.
  2. Get instant grading and coaching. Every call is scored in seconds across five dimensions: rapport, objection handling, active listening, compliance, and resolution — with specific coaching tips reps can apply immediately.
  3. Certify your team. Supervisor dashboards show readiness scorecards, skill heatmaps, and improvement trends, so managers know exactly who is ready to go live.
